人工智能工程师的岗位职责
在当今数字化时代的快速发展中,人工智能(Artificial Intelligence,简称AI)作为一种重要的前沿技术,为各行业带来了巨大的创新和改变。作为人工智能领域的专业人才,人工智能工程师在推动人工智能技术应用和发展方面发挥着至关重要的作用。本文将介绍人工智能工程师的岗位职责。
一、算法设计与开发
作为人工智能工程师,最核心的职责之一是进行算法的设计与开发。这包括了研究和探索各种机器学习算法、深度学习算法以及其他相关的人工智能算法。人工智能工程师需要熟悉并掌握各种常用的机器学习库和深度学习框架,如TensorFlow、PyTorch等。通过设计和开发新的算法模型,人工智能工程师能够为解决实际问题提供创新的解决方案,并不断推动人工智能技术的进步。
二、数据处理与预处理
在实际应用中,人工智能算法需要大量的数据进行训练和优化。人工智能工程师的岗位职责之
一是进行数据的处理与预处理。这包括数据的清洗、特征提取、数据标注和数据集的构建等工作。通过合理处理和预处理数据,可以提高人工智能算法的训练效果和推理能力。
三、模型建立与训练
人工智能工程师需要根据实际需求,选择合适的人工智能模型进行建立和训练。这要求他们对各种常用的人工智能模型有深刻的理解和熟练的掌握,如卷积神经网络(Convolutional Neural Network,CNN)、循环神经网络(Recurrent Neural Network,RNN)等。通过对模型的训练,可以使其具备较强的学习和决策能力,实现对复杂问题的解决。
四、模型优化与调参
在模型训练过程中,人工智能工程师需要不断优化模型的性能。这涉及到参数调整、损失函数优化、正则化技术等,在保证模型准确度的同时尽量降低过拟合的风险。通过不断的优化与调参,使模型能够更好地适应实际应用场景的需求。
五、系统集成与部署
人工智能工程师的岗位职责还包括对人工智能算法进行系统集成与部署。这要求他们具备较强的工程实践能力,能够将算法模型与实际系统相结合,实现人工智能算法在实际应用场景中的部署与运行。此外,人工智能工程师还需要对算法在实际应用中出现的问题进行及时的排查和修复,保证系统的稳定性和性能。
六、技术研究与创新
作为技术领域的从业者,人工智能工程师需要不断进行技术研究与创新。他们需要关注最新的人工智能技术动态,参与学术研究与交流,并在实际工作中提出创新的解决方案。通过不断的学习与探索,人工智能工程师可以不断提高自己的技术水平,推动人工智能技术的发展。
七、团队协作与沟通
人工智能工程师往往需要与团队中的其他成员进行紧密的合作。他们需要与产品经理、设计师、软件工程师等人员密切配合,共同完成项目的开发与实施。此外,人工智能工程师还需要与非技术人员进行有效的沟通,将复杂的技术概念和方法以简单明了的方式传达出来,使得技术与业务能够有效对接。
总结:
人工智能ai正则化使用方法人工智能工程师是推动人工智能技术发展的中坚力量,他们承担着算法设计、数据处理、模型训练、系统集成与部署等重要职责。通过不断的技术研究与创新,他们为解决实际问题提供了有力的支持。同时,团队协作与沟通也是人工智能工程师不可或缺的能力。随着人工智能技术的飞速发展,人工智能工程师的职责和责任也将不断拓展和深化。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。